Candlemass, the Swedish pioneers of epic doom meta Candlemass, the Swedish pioneers of epic doom metal, have released their 40th-anniversary EP, Black Star, on May 9, 2025, via Napalm Records. This four-track release features two new songs and two cover versions of classic tracks.

The title track, “Black Star,” showcases haunting melodies and introspective lyrics, delivered by vocalist Johan Längqvist. “Corridors of Chaos” is an instrumental piece highlighting guitarist Lars Johansson’s dynamic playing. The EP also includes covers of Black Sabbath’s “Sabbath Bloody Sabbath” and Pentagram’s “Forever My Queen,” paying homage to the band’s influences. 

Black Star is available in various formats, including digital, CD, and limited-edition vinyl. The special vinyl edition features a 12-page booklet, an A3 poster.
